Interviews with eduStyle blog award nominees

edustyle-awards-banner.gifKarine Joly at College Web Editor has posted her recent email interviews with the folks behind four of the six blogs nominated for the eduStyle Awards for best student blogs and best institutional blogs.

Disclaimer: I am the person behind one of the blogs in contention, Missouri S&T’s Name Change Conversations, and my interview is included in Karine’s post. My responses were articulate, well-reasoned and succinct, but please, don’t let that sway your vote. *wink wink nudge nudge*

Seriously, though. The interviews offer insight into the motives behind each of these outstanding blogs. Each entry seeks to achieve different goals, focusing on different audiences, and each seems to have made strides toward achieving the stated goals.
